Director of Education

Surrey, Metro Vancouver Regional District, Canada

Abbotsford, BC GENERAL SUMMARY

The Director of Education is responsible for delivering a high quality personal customer experience byensuring that the ongoing educational needs of Sylvan families are met and that our education programs are delivered by teachers as designed. To ensure a personal learning experience, the Directormonitors student performance, meets regularly with families, and connects with school teachers tohelp ensure the application of skills learned in the classroom. The Director also observes and coachesthe teaching staff, ensuring robust instructional experiences. When the Center Director is unavailableor not in the Center, the Director of Education serves as the point-of-contact for customers andmanages Center operations.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

Supports the Centre Directorin delivering assessments to students, updating lesson plans, and preparing teaching materials.

Teach the Sylvan curriculum in a 3:1 setting to students when necessary. Candidatewill interact with and motivate students during instruction, and evaluate and document student progress after instruction.

Manages and delivers all conference activities such as preparing conference materials andmeeting with parents to keep families enrolled in Sylvan.

Ensures that all teachers are trained and certified to deliver Sylvan programs and monitors teachers performance.

Motivates and develops staff by providing ongoing learning opportunities.

Monitors student progress to ensure goals are achieved and ongoing family needs are met.

Conducts parent conferences on a regular and timely basis, with appropriate documentation.

Maintains regular contact with the schools via teacher conference either in-person, via e-mail or over the telephone.

Communicates with the Centre Director any concerns regarding student progress or instructor performance.

May also be required to make school visits, establish and maintain relationships with schoolsfor partnership and marketing purposes.

KNOWLEDGE REQUIRED

Bachelor's Degree in Education or related field from an accredited university

Minimum of one or two years of teaching experience preferred; Experience in supervisor rolepreferred

Knowledge of current BC educational curriculum and policy

Previous retail and/or sales experience preferred

Be comfortableworking with computers and have a good working knowledge of Microsoft Word and Excel. Knowledge of iPads and Zoom an asset.

SKILLS AND ABILITIES REQUIRED

Proven ability to engage, motivate, and inspire students to learn

Be hard-working, exude empathy and love working with children

Strong customer service, interpersonal, and communication skills

Proven ability to discuss and sell Sylvan products and services to new and existing customers

Be a self-starter who is able to manage multiple tasks and competing priorities. Candidateis also articulate, organized, professional, detail-oriented, and able to problem-solve in a fast-paced environment with minimal supervision

Proven ability to communicate effectively in writing as appropriate for the needs of theaudience

Ability to work collaboratively; strong team player

Ability to work a flexible schedule

Have reliable transportation (vehicle preferred)
